STEP I: THE BEGINNER
Focus: Self-Discovery and
Goal Setting

Goal: Reflect deeply on what


you truly want to achieve,
whether it’s weight loss,
muscle gain, improved health,
or overall well-bein

Assess your current starting point: your fitness level,


potential, and personal limitations. This foundational
step sets the stage for all future progress.
Key Actions:
1.Define your goals:
-Write down SMART goals (Specific, Measurable,
Achievable, Realistic, and Time-bound)
-Examples: "Lose 5 kg in 3 months" or "Gain 3 kg of
lean muscle in 6 months." These goals provide
direction and motivation.

2.Identify obstacles:
-List potential obstacles, such as lack of time,
unhealthy habits, or lack of knowledge.

4
-Develop practical strategies to overcome these
challenges, such as scheduling your workouts or
seeking professional advice.

3.Change your mindset:


-Accept the fact that significant progress takes
time and requires consistent effort.
-Focus on building habits rather than seeking quick
results. Sustainable change is based on small daily
actions.
Tools

-Use a fitness journal to document your


goals, thoughts, and progress.
-Perform a basic fitness test to establish a
baseline (e.g., measure your weight, body fat
percentage, or take a photo).

STEP II: THE NOVICE
Focus: Healthy Habits and Consistency
Goal: Create fundamental habits that lay the
foundation for long-term success.
Key Actions:
1.Training:
-Commit to training at least 3 times a week.
Consistency is more important than intensity at this
stage.
-Focus on learning proper form and technique rather
than lifting heavy weights to avoid injuries and build
your confidence.

Tools
-Start by incorporating whole, nutrient-dense foods
into your diet, such as vegetables, lean proteins, and
whole grains.
- Gradually reduce processed foods, sugary drinks,
and unnecessary snacks.

6
3.Recovery:
-Ensure you get 7 to 9 hours of quality sleep each
night to allow your body to repair and strengthen
-Incorporate active recovery activities such as
stretching or light walking on rest days.

Advice:

-Celebrate small victories along the way, such


as completing a week of workouts or making
healthier food choices.
-Avoid complicating your routine. Simplicity and
consistency will yield the best results.

STEP III: THE AMATEUR
Focus: Structured Progress

Goal: Transition from occasional


efforts to a structured approach that
accelerates your progress and yields
measurable results.

Key Actions:
Calculate calories and macronutrients:
-Determine your daily caloric needs
and macronutrient breakdown using
the method outlined in the bonus
section.

- Adjust these calculations to your specific goals, such


as fat loss or muscle gain.
2.Follow a structured training program:
-Commit to training 4 to 5 times a week, focusing on
compound movements like squats, deadlifts, and
bench presses for maximum efficiency.
-Incorporate progressive overload by gradually
increasing weights, reps, or intensity to stimulate
muscle growth and strength gains.

8
3.Track your progress:
-Use tools like fitness apps or journals to record your
workouts, meals, and progress photos.
-Regularly assess your performance and adjust your
plan as needed to stay on track.

Mindset :

Cultivate discipline. At this stage, motivation


alone is no longer enough. Understand that
progress may be slow but steady. Trust the
process and persevere.

STEP IV: THE PLATEAU

Focus: Diagnosis and Adjustment


Goal: Identify the reasons for the slowdown in
progress and make the necessary adjustments
to restart progress.
Key Actions:
Diagnose the problem:
-Reevaluate your goals, tracking data, and overall
progress.
-Identify areas that need improvement, such as
insufficient recovery, unbalanced nutrition, or lack of
intensity in training.
2.Adapt your plan:
-Introduce variety into your workouts by trying new
exercises, changing repetition patterns, or increasing
intensity.
-Adjust your caloric intake or macronutrient ratios
based on your current needs.

10
3.Prioritize recovery:
-Incorporate mobility exercises, foam rolling, and
regular stretching to improve flexibility and prevent
injuries.
-Ensure your body gets the necessary time to recover
between intense sessions.

Mindset:

View plateaus as opportunities for learning and


growth. They are an integral part of the fitness
journey and often indicate that it’s time to refine
your strategy.

Bonus Section: How to Calculate Basal Metabolic
Rate (BMR) and Macronutrients

Step 1: Calculate your BMR (using the Mifflin-St


Jeor equation):
For men:
BMR = (10 x weight in kg) + (6.25 x height in cm) -
(5 x age in years) + 5
For women:
BMR = (10 x weight in kg) + (6.25 x height in cm) -
(5 x age in years) - 161 (Note: the original formula
has -161, not -16)

Step 2: Adjust based on activity level:


Sedentary: BMR x 1.2
Light activity (1-3 times per week): BMR x
1.375
Moderate activity (3-5 times per week): BMR
x 1.55
Intense activity (6-7 times per week): BMR x
1.725
Very intense activity (heavy physical labor):
BMR x 1.9

14
Step 3: Define your goal:
To lose weight: Reduce daily calories by 10 to
20%.
To gain muscle: Increase daily calories by 10
to 20%.

Step 4: Calculate the macronutrients:


Proteins: 1.6-2.2 g per kg of body weight.
Fats: 20-30% of total calories.
Carbohydrates: Remaining calories after
calculating protein and fat.

EPractical Example:-Weight: 70 kg-Height: 175


cm-Age: 25 years-Activity level: Moderate (1.55)
BMR Calculation:
BMR = (10 x 70) + (6.25 x 175) - (5 x 25) + 5 =
1662.5 kcal
Total Calories:
Total Calories = 1662.5 x 1.55 = 2577 kcal
To lose weight:
Calories for weight loss = 2577 x 0.8 = 2061 kcal
Macronutrients:
Proteins: 140 g (4 kcal/g = 560 kcal)
Fats: 60 g (9 kcal/g = 540 kcal)
Carbohydrates: Remaining calories (2061 -
560 - 540 = 961 kcal, 961 / 4 = 240 g
